Giants agree to terms with second-round pick Joseph

Football Betting Lines

07/31/2010 - East Rutherford, NJ (Sportsbook Betting Lines) - The New York Giants have reportedly agreed to terms on a contract with defensive tackle Linval Joseph.

Joseph was selected 45th overall by the Giants in this year's draft. The Star- Ledger reports that the deal will be worth a little more than $4 million.

New York's first-round pick, Jason Pierre-Paul, is the club's only unsigned draft pick.

Chiefs' Treen Green out for Sunday's game

How long Trent Green will remain sidelined is unknown. Coach Herm Edwards said Monday he will miss a second straight start Sunday when the Chiefs host the San Francisco 49ers.

A two-time Pro Bowler, Green was going into a feet-first hook slide when he was knocked unconscious by a thunderous, head-snapping hit from Cincinnati's Robert Geathers.
